Warmer colors are created when the hue is shifted towards red, orange and yellow. These colors convey warmth, energy and an inviting atmosphere.

The following warmer sh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D7F362, #F3E762, #F3C062, #F39962 and #F37262

They are stimulating and dynamic and are often used to attract attention or create a friendly and lively mood. An example of this transition is a shift from a cool blue through purple to red and orange.

Colder colors are created by shifting the hue towards green, blue and violet.

The following colder sh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D7F362, #B0F362, #89F362, #62F362 and #62F389

These colors have a cool, calming effect and create distance. They are often used to convey a sense of calm, freshness and stability. A classic example of this color range is a gradient from yellow to green to a deep blue or violet, reminiscent of water and sky.

The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#D8F365 shade: #F3C062, #F3E762, #D8F362, #B2F362 and #8BF362

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

The partial complementary color scheme is a variation of the complementary color scheme. In addition to the base color, the two colors adjacent to the complement are used.

The following split-complementary sh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D8F365, #62F399 and #D362F3

This color scheme has the same strong visual contrast as the complementary color scheme, but is not as contrasting as the direct complementary color. The partial complementary color scheme is a good choice for designs. These colors usually complement each other very well.

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D8F365, #62D8F3 and #F362D8

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D8F365, #62F399, #7D62F3 and #F362BB

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.

The following squaren shades match the #D8F365 shade: #D8F365, #62F3C5, #7D62F3 and #F36290

Again, p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design.

With this color yellow stands out from the other colors. The values representing the red and green hue are greater than the third value. They are close together and exceed the value of the blue hue. Since the color values are relatively high compared to others, this hue appears lighter to us.

The breakdown of the color into the RGB color system: of 255 maximum color components, 216 red, 243 green and 101 blue.

The mixing ratio of these colors results in the displayed hue in the middle of the overlaps.

In the illustration you can see how the color is composed of the three components: red (top),green (bottom right) and blue (bottom left). In the middle you can see the result color.
216 243 101 R G B
In the CMYK color system the color is composed as follows: In this color tone, out of 100 maximum color components, 11 cyan, none magenta, 58 yellow and 5 key.

The mixing ratio of these colors results in the displayed hue in the middle of the overlaps.

In the diagram you can see how the color is composed of the four components cyan (top left),magenta (top right),yellow (bottom right) and black or key (bottom left). In the middle you can see the result color.
11% 0% 58% 5% C M Y K
